Lakeport Police logs: Thursday, Jan. 6

Thursday, January 6, 2011

 

12:14 a.m. – Traffic stop. Sgt. Jason Ferguson initiated activity at Spurr Street and Bryce Court. Warning given.

 

8:39 a.m. – California Highway Patrol assist. Detective Destry Henderson initiated activity at South State Highway 29 and Clayton Creek Road, Lower Lake. Southbound blocked, negative injury. Outside agency assist.

 

8:46 a.m. – Vandalism. Vandalism reported in alley behind Angelina’s Bakery, Third and N. Forbes streets. General services rendered.

 

11:36 a.m. – Citizen assist. A dead deer is reported between Lakeport Tire and Kragen, near the sidewalk. Referred to another agency.

 

12:07 p.m. – Health and safety. Lakeport Corp Yard, Martin Street, reported a bag of marijuana found. Report taken.

 

1:44 p.m. – Suspicious person. Sgt. Dale Stoebe and Officer Norm Taylor responded to McDonald’s, Todd Road. An unknown male is inside the store talking to himself and acting strange. He was there last week as well. General services rendered.

 

3:01 p.m. – Shoplifter. Sgt. Dale Stoebe responded to Grocery Outlet, S. Main Street. There is a shoplifter in the office who is not cooperating; possible high. Arrest made.

 

9:38 p.m. – Welfare check. Sgt. Jason Ferguson responded to request for welfare check on the caller’s 11-year-old son. The caller received a call from his son, advising that his mother assaulted him. The caller stated he has a restraining order, but none is found. General services rendered.
